ORDER ON BOARD 28/01/2026
1. Petitioner has filed this writ petition seeking following reliefs.

Learned counsel for petitioner submits that petitioner is holding post of Jail warder and at present posted at Central Jail, Bilaspur. He contended that petitioner has taken treatment for herself during the period from 06.12.2024 to 03.03.2025, but till date respondents have not taken any decision on the reimbursement claim of petitioner dated 10.11.2025 and the claim of petitioner is still pending consideration before Respondent No. 3. He further submits that till date respondent no. 3 has not considered and passed any
order for reimbursement of medical bills, claim of petitioner and therefore, direction be issued to respondent no. 3 to take decision on the application of petitioner for reimbursement of medical claim of petitioner, at the earliest.
3. Learned State counsel submits that as the petitioner is only seeking for direction to be issued to respondent no. 3 to take decision on the representation submitted by petitioner for reimbursement of medical bills, she is having no objection to the limited prayer.
4. On due consideration of the submission made by learned counsel for the respective parties, without commenting anything on the merits of claim of petitioner, this writ petition at this stage is disposed of with a direction to respondent no. 3 to consider the application of petitioner with regard to reimbursement of medical bills as also the representation submitted by her, on 10.11.2025, in accordance with law, expeditiously preferably within a further period of 06 weeks from the date of receipt of copy of order passed by this Court.
5. Accordingly, this writ petition is disposed of with the aforesaid observation and direction. Sd/- (Parth Prateem Sahu) pwn
